The property
Just one street back from stunning Lake Hawea, tucked in, high up on the lake moraine is where you'll find Korimako Ridge. When you yearn for a relaxing holiday in a special place, look no further than Korimako Ridge. In winter you can enjoy this great location and come home after a day skiing to this warm, comfortable home with double glazed windows. In summer enjoy the proximity to the lake and the beautiful garden. The open plan living dining and kitchen areas open onto summer shaded decks and a private courtyard - ideal for keeping cool on summer days. The garden and others around are the haunts of various native songbirds keen to feast on the flowers in the gardens as well as the fruit from apricot and cherry trees nearby. Listen for the bellbird (Korimako.) In Winter afternoons this house is a bright and cosy holiday home. Ideal for settling down by the fire with a glass of wine whilst winding down from a day's skiing. The house is also equpiied with double glazing to keep you warm and your surrounds quiet. Close, convenient access to two restaurants, a convenience store, a village Library, and tennis courts. To Lake Hawea and Hawea River walking and biking tracks to the fabulous Albert Town. Summer swimming, boating, fishing and other recreation in the pristine waters of this beautiful lake. A convenient fifteen-minute drive between forests, mountains and plains but away from the hustle and bustle of Wanaka township. Korimako Ridge is well-placed in any season for day excursions to surrounding Wanaka, Cromwell areas and Makaora with its beautiful blue pools. Planning to get up in the mountains for the snow? You will be less than an hours drive from Treble Cone and Cardrona Skifields. And just over an hours drive from Queenstown. Tranquil, peaceful Lake Hawea is just a 15 minute scenic drive out of Wanaka, and is the perfect spot for those who love swimming, boating or hiking. Home to some of the country's best fly-fishing spots, you can also take in the breathtaking views with a hike up Isthmus Peak or mountain biking across to Wanaka!
